Swollen Ankles
|
 |
Swollen ankles can be both unsightly and
uncomfortable. Ankles swell because of fluid
retention, so if you suffer frequently from
this condition, you may want to investigate
both its cause (to rule out a serious circulatory
or other problem) and a remedy.
An ounce of prevention can help many people
who suffer from swollen ankles. If you find
your ankles periodically swelling, try keeping
a diary and recording the things you eat
and activities you do; once you find your
feet swelling, see if you can correlate it
to any of the recent entries in your diary.
For example, high salt and high carbohydrate
diets can cause swelling, so look to see
what you had been eating prior to the episode.
Similarly, medication or allergies may cause
the swelling, so track what you take and
when you take it.
We have all heard about the need to buy shoes
later rather than earlier in the day. That
is because a lot of standing causes fluid
to settle in our feet and ankles, so shoes
bought in the morning may not fit by the
end of the day. For the same reason, swollen
ankles can be triggered by a lot standing;
consequently, try to sit frequently in a
comfortable position with your legs raised
above your heart. Walking is another alternative,
as the exercise increases your circulation.
If you must stand a lot, investigate buying
compression socks or stockings to offset the effects of gravity. These
are specially designed hosiery that provided
increasing pressure on your legs as they
approach the ankle to discourage the pooling
of fluids. |
